Foot missing.
Deep, sharply tapering, ovoid body; tall neck, ridged at line of upper handle-attachments; broad projecting torus rim, flat on top; strap handles, double-curved. Clay pink at core, buff at surfaces; rim, neck and upper part of shoulder reserved; below, thick rather dull black glaze, much worn. Non-Attic.
A high moulded base, like that seen on contemporary figured neck-amphorae, e.g. Richter and Milne, fig. 23, might have been appropriate. The prominent rim and elaborately curved handles imitate fine ware.
